www.yunchucloud.cn 发布时间:2026-07-03 22:00:19
消防工程企业的网站二次开发通常围绕资质展示、项目案例查询、消防设备参数查询、在线报修预约等核心功能展开。不少企业在初次开发时仅搭建了基础展示框架,随着业务扩张,需要对接消防监管部门的数据接口、企业内部ERP系统的项目数据,或是新增消防知识科普、应急方案下载等模块,此时二次开发就成为必然选择。在通用行业场景中,不少企业会先梳理现有网站的架构缺陷,比如部分老旧的PHP架构网站无法支撑高并发的设备参数查询请求,或是前端静态资源未做CDN加速,导致异地用户访问延迟较高。如果企业需要拓展线上业务,还可以了解更多关于大武口厨房电器加工企业商城网站开发流程第...的技术细节,提前规划架构升级方案。
二次开发过程中需要优先明确现有网站的代码冗余情况,比如部分早期开发的网站存在大量未使用的JS脚本、重复调用的CSS样式,这些都会拖慢页面加载速度。同时要注意消防工程相关的特殊内容规范,比如消防资质证书的上传格式、项目案例中的涉密信息脱敏处理,这些都需要在二次开发的需求文档中明确标注,避免后续返工。
接口响应慢是消防工程企业网站二次开发过程中高频出现的问题,排查时可以从服务端、网络层、代码逻辑三个维度逐步定位。以下是不同排查方向的技术点对比:
| 排查维度 | 常见原因 | 排查工具 | 优化方案 |
|---|---|---|---|
| 服务端 | 数据库查询未建索引、服务器配置不足 | MySQL慢查询日志、top命令 | 给项目表的项目编号、地区字段加索引,升级服务器带宽 |
| 网络层 | 跨地域接口调用无CDN、DNS解析延迟高 | ping、traceroute、Chrome DevTools | 部署接口CDN节点,更换公共DNS服务商 |
| 代码逻辑 | 接口冗余校验、循环嵌套查询数据库 | Xdebug、Postman | 精简校验逻辑,用批量查询替换循环单条查询 |
排查时可以先通过Chrome DevTools的Network面板查看接口的具体耗时分布,如果TTFB(等待服务器响应时间)超过500ms,基本可以定位为服务端或代码逻辑问题;如果TTFB正常但整体加载慢,则大概率是网络传输层面的问题。如果企业需要对接第三方消防数据接口,还可以参考哈尔滨精细化工产品企业小程序设计制作的技...中的接口优化方案,适配移动端的低带宽场景。